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Repair
Beyond the initial damage, water damage can cause hidden problems that can compromise your property’s integrity and your health. Ignoring these signs can lead to costly repairs, structural damage, and even health risks. Here are some common warning signs to watch out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of mold growth or water damage. If you notice a musty smell in your home, especially after a storm or flood, it’s essential to investigate the source and address the issue quickly.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water can seep into floors, causing warping, buckling, or even complete failure. If you notice uneven or sagging floors, it may be a sign of water damage that needs prompt attention.
Discoloration or Staining
Water damage can cause discoloration or staining on walls, ceilings, and floors. If you notice unusual discoloration or staining, it’s a good idea to investigate the source and address the issue before it becomes a more significant problem.
Water Spots or Stains
Water spots or stains on ceilings, walls, and floors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ice these marks, it’s essential to investigate the source and address the issue to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Water damage can cause peeling paint or wallpaper, especially around windows, doors, and other areas prone to moisture. If you notice peeling paint or wallpaper, it may be a sign of water damage that needs attention.

Water Damage Repair Cost in Golf, FL
The cost of water damage repair can vary widely dep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Golf, FL. As a general estimate, here are some typical price ranges for different aspects of water damage repair: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, equipment needed, and duration of drying process.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of surfaces, and equipment needed. |
| Repairs and re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s, and materials needed. |

What causes water damage?
Water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including storms, floods, burst pipes, appliance malfunctions, and even sewer backups. If you’re unsure about the source of the damage, our team can help you investigate and develop a plan to prevent future issues.
